Preparation of Coated Cellulose Tri(4 methylbenzoate) Chiral Stationary Phases and Their Application in Enantioseparation

Abstract:
      Based on C8 modified macroporous silica,a coated cellulose tri(4 methylbenzoate)(CTMB) chiral stationary phases(CSPs) were prepared.Influences of coating solvent and additive on the enantioselectivity of CSP were investigated.Several CSPs were prepared by coating CTMB in chloroform and dichloromethane,with N,N’ dimethylformamide(DMF),phenol,nitrobenzene,methyl benzoate and acetophenone as additives,respectively.The enantioselectivities of CSPs were evaluated by using 7 structurally different enantiomers.It was found that column efficiency,retention ability and enantioselectivity of CSPs were affected by the type and amount of additive.The addition of the same amount of methyl benzoate with CTMB would provide the CSPs with better properties,which exhibit a good enantioseparation ability for racemic simendan intermediate and ketorolac,and possess an application potential in industrial preparation and separation.
